
Ver consultas del Agente SQL usando OpenAI y Quickchart.io
Genera representaciones visuales a partir de consultas SQL utilizando OpenAI y Quickchart.io.
Cómo funciona
El flujo de trabajo titulado "Ver consultas del Agente SQL usando OpenAI y Quickchart.io" está diseñado para generar representaciones visuales de consultas SQL aprovechando las capacidades de OpenAI para el procesamiento del lenguaje natural y Quickchart.io para la generación de gráficos. El flujo de trabajo opera a través de una serie de nodos interconectados que facilitan el flujo y el procesamiento de datos.
1. Nodo desencadenante:
el flujo de trabajo comienza con un nodo desencadenante que inicia el proceso. Esto podría ser un disparador manual o un disparador basado en eventos según la configuración.
2. Nodo de consulta SQL:
el primer nodo operativo es responsable de ejecutar una consulta SQL en una base de datos específica. Este nodo recupera datos que serán analizados y visualizados.
3. Nodo OpenAI:
después de obtener los resultados de la consulta SQL, los datos se pasan al nodo OpenAI. Este nodo procesa los datos utilizando la API de OpenAI para generar una descripción o análisis en lenguaje natural de los resultados de la consulta SQL. La salida de este nodo es una representación textual que resume los conocimientos derivados de los datos SQL.
4. Nodo Quickchart.io:
el siguiente paso consiste en enviar los datos procesados al nodo Quickchart.io. Este nodo toma el resultado del nodo OpenAI y lo utiliza para crear un gráfico visual. Quickchart.io genera un gráfico basado en las especificaciones proporcionadas, que puede incluir varios tipos de visualizaciones, como gráficos de barras, gráficos de líneas, etc.
5. Nodo de salida:
Finalmente, el flujo de trabajo concluye con un nodo de salida que presenta el gráfico generado. Esto podría ser en forma de un enlace URL a la imagen del gráfico o una representación visual incrustada, según la configuración del nodo de salida.
A lo largo de este proceso, los datos fluyen sin problemas de un nodo a otro, y cada nodo realiza una función específica que contribuye al objetivo general de visualizar los resultados de las consultas SQL.
Características clave
- Procesamiento del lenguaje natural:
la integración con OpenAI permite un análisis sofisticado de los resultados de las consultas SQL, transformando los datos sin procesar en información comprensible.
- Generación dinámica de gráficos:
Quickchart.io proporciona la capacidad de crear gráficos dinámicos y personalizables basados en los datos procesados, mejorando el atractivo visual y la interpretabilidad de los resultados.
- Flujo de trabajo automatizado:
todo el proceso está automatizado, lo que permite a los usuarios generar representaciones visuales de consultas SQL sin intervención manual, ahorrando tiempo y reduciendo errores.
- Opciones de salida versátiles:
el flujo de trabajo se puede configurar para generar varios tipos de visualizaciones, atendiendo a las diferentes necesidades y preferencias del usuario.
- Integración con bases de datos SQL:
la capacidad de ejecutar consultas SQL directamente desde el flujo de trabajo lo hace muy útil para analistas y desarrolladores de datos que necesitan visualizar información de bases de datos rápidamente.
Integración de herramientas
- OpenAI:
Se utiliza para procesar y generar descripciones en lenguaje natural a partir de resultados de consultas SQL.
- Quickchart.io:
Se emplea para crear representaciones visuales de los datos, lo que permite a los usuarios generar cuadros y gráficos fácilmente.
- n8n SQL Node:
Este nodo se utiliza para ejecutar consultas SQL contra una base de datos, recuperando los datos necesarios para el análisis.
- Nodo de solicitud HTTP n8n:
este nodo probablemente se use para interactuar con las API OpenAI y Quickchart.io, enviando solicitudes y recibiendo respuestas.
Se requieren claves API
- Clave API de OpenAI:
necesaria para autenticar solicitudes al servicio OpenAI para procesar los resultados de consultas SQL.
- Clave API Quickchart.io:
Necesaria para generar gráficos a través del servicio Quickchart.io, asegurando que las solicitudes estén autorizadas.
- Credenciales de la base de datos:
dependiendo de la configuración del nodo SQL, es posible que también se requieran credenciales para acceder a la base de datos, incluido el nombre de usuario, la contraseña y el nombre de la base de datos.
Este flujo de trabajo combina eficazmente el poder de la inteligencia artificial y las herramientas de visualización de datos para mejorar el análisis de consultas SQL, lo que lo convierte en un activo valioso para la toma de decisiones basada en datos.










